Care Coordinator

Aurora, CO, United States

Description

Summary:

At the direction of professional Care Management or Social Work staff, coordinates transitions of care, conducts and documents socio-economic review and screening to support the coordination of care.

Work Schedule: Full Time Days

Responsibilities:

Coordinates with outside agencies, post-acute care or specialty facilities, transportation agencies, and others as indicated. Assists clients and patients in connecting with appropriate Physicians, insurers, Payer programs, and other resources to meet social and clinical needs.

Collaborates with the care management and behavioral health teams for effective patient or client outreach, care coordination and hand-overs across the continuum of care. Refers patients and provides educational resources to patients per protocols.

Conducts scripted phone calls and accesses systems to retrieve patient information for clinical care team and send appropriate information for placement or transfer. Retrieves record, imaging and diagnostic results, pathology and other requests for treatment teams.

Arranges care conferences as needed. Supports Inpatient and Ambulatory multidisciplinary team meetings as assigned. Works with internal and external resources to coordinate placement, discharge planning, case management, behavioral health and follow-up care.

Within scope of job, requires critical thinking skills, decisive judgement and the ability to work with minimal supervision. Must be able to work in a fast-paced environment and take appropriate action.

Requirements:

Minimum Required Education: High School diploma or GED.

Required Licensure/Certification: None required.

Minimum Experience: None required. Preferred: 1 year relevant experience.
